If you’re looking for the perfect town and country getaway, by Jove, this is it! This 7-day tour of London and the surrounding countryside is just the right balance of city and scenery, royalty and ruins, and landmarks and landscapes. With six nights in London, you’ll relish plenty of time along the Thames as well as exciting day trips that trade Big Ben for the small, quaint villages of England. Beyond London’s legendary parks and palaces, you’ll explore Shakespeare’s roots in lovely Stratford-upon-Avon, walk the medieval streets of scholarly Oxford, study the cryptic remnants of prehistoric Stonehenge, and ponder the mystery of the curious stones as you enjoy a cuppa in one of Salisbury’s half-timbered tearooms. Serving up the right balance of guided, must-see sightseeing with ample free time to explore London on your own, this tour of London and country is the bee’s knees.

Tour Itinerary

Day 1
ARRIVE IN LONDON, ENGLAND
Welcome to London! Meet your Tour Director upon arrival at your hotel. Free time this afternoon before a welcome dinner, followed by a [LOCAL FAVORITE] private, narrated cruise on the Thames River. (D) LOCAL FAVORITE EPIC RIDE Experience a leisurely cruise on the gentle Thames River. In the company of a Local Guide enjoy a unique look at London as you glide serenely on this chief river of southern England, which flows from the Cotswolds Hills to the North Sea.
Day 2
LONDON
The Royal Treatment Morning sightseeing with a Local Guide includes sights of the Houses of Parliament, Big Ben, Westminster Abbey, Whitehall, the Prime Minister’s Downing Street residence, Piccadilly Circus, Buckingham Palace, and a visit to St. Paul’s Cathedral. The remainder of the day is free to explore England’s capital city. (B) TOUR HIGHLIGHT HISTORIC SPOTS England’s national treasure of St. Paul’s Cathedral is home to a spectacular array of art from delicate carvings to gilded dome murals and modern works of art. As the seat of the Bishop of London, the cathedral serves as the mother church of the Diocese of London, where notable remembrances have been served here, including Queen Victoria’s jubilee, birthdays of Queen Elizabeth II, and funerals of luminaries like Winston Churchill and Margaret Thatcher.
Day 3
LONDON
On the Town in London Today you are free to continue to explore London at your own pace. Maybe travel to Windsor Castle, the oldest and largest occupied castle in the world, where Prince Harry and Meghan Markle,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ex, were married. In August and September, there’s the opportunity to visit Buckingham Palace and stroll through the magnificent State Rooms, used by the Royal Family, for ceremonial occasions and official entertaining. (B) TOUR HIGHLIGHT LEGENDS & LORE Double-decker buses, Piccadilly Circus, London Bridge, British pubs, and sweet shops are waiting to be discovered with a leisurely day in London town. Find your hideaway in Hyde Park’s lush gardens or find styles to suit your fancy in some of Britain’s most famous boutiques in Mayfair, Kensington, or Chelsea.
Day 4
LONDON. EXCURSION TO SHAKESPEARE COUNTRY
Country Charm & Classmates Set out for an exciting day of sightseeing. In Stratford-upon-Avon, visit Shakespeare’s Schoolroom and Guildhall and see where one of the world’s greatest playwrights was educated. There’s time to enjoy free time in this Elizabethan town before a drive through the picturesque villages and idyllic rolling landscapes of the Cotswolds. The final highlight is a walking tour through the university city of Oxford, viewing colleges and dreaming spires! 216 mi / 348 km (B) LOCAL FAVORITE HISTORIC SPOT If “the play’s the thing” then this is the place where the world’s greatest playwright penned his first tale. Find your seat during a fun visit to the schoolroom where a young William Shakespeare sat in the 1570s to learn the power of language. Also, discover Stratford’s Guildhall where he attended plays performed by the finest actors of the day.
Day 5
LONDON. EXCURSION TO STONEHENGE & SALISBURY
Stone Temples & Time Travel Today’s excursion brings you to mysterious Stonehenge. Explore the visitor center, then take the shuttle to the stone circle and admire this fascinating monument up close. On to the medieval cathedral city of Salisbury for some free time before returning to London. 186 mi / 299 km (B) TOUR HIGHLIGHT HISTORY & MYSTERY Ponder the who, what, why, and how of Stonehenge, one of the most impressive prehistoric megalithic monuments in the world. Its sheer size and sophisticated architectural design have earned its legendary reverence as the most famous prehistoric monument in the world. Although its original purpose is a mystery, the concentric monuments hold spiritual significance for people from around the world who gather at the massive stone circles to celebrate the summer solstice.
Day 6
LONDON
Leisurely Day in London Town A final day in London offers plenty more time to get better acquainted with this fascinating city. Explore on your own or join one of the optional excursions on offer. (B) TOUR HIGHLIGHT CITY SIGHTS A character in Jane Austen’s Pride & Prejudice noted “London is so diverting; there is so much to entertain!” This is even more true today, from its panoramic views of wide-open spaces and leafy landscapes to its bustling British sense and sensibilities, museums, galleries, and iconic sights. Mingle with the serenity of Hampstead Heath and Kensington Gardens. Be enthralled by a dazzling show at one of the West End’s historic stages - a fabulous bookend to your time in London.
Day 7
LONDON
Safe travels until we meet again! Your vacation ends with breakfast this morning. (B)
